Description

COMMUNAL FRONT DOOR
Key fob access opening to

LOBBY
Communal stairs and lift service to 2nd floor. Mailboxes. Electric and water meters.

PRIVATE FRONT DOOR
Opening into

ENTRANCE HALLWAY
'L' shaped entrance hallway, radiator, two ceiling light points, hardwired smoke detector, built in storage cupboard also housing meters, further storage cupboard also housing HRV (Heat Recovery Ventilation) system in a flat which continuously exchanges stale indoor air with fresh outdoor air, preheating or pre-cooling the incoming air with heat recovered from the outgoing air to improve air quality and save energy, wall mounted video entry system.

BATHROOM 6'9 x 6'9 (2.06m x 2.06m)
Internal bathroom with recessed spotlighting, extractor fan, panelled bath with thermostatic mixer tap and shower attachment, part tiled walls, chrome ladder style radiator, low level W.C. with concealed cistern and push plate dual flush, inset wash basin with mixer tap and pop up waste, tiled over shelf to side, vinyl flooring.

BEDROOM 11'5 x 10'5 (3.48m x 3.18m)
Westerly aspect, ceiling light point, hardwired smoke detector, extractor duct, built in double wardrobe with hanging and storage space, radiator, double glazed door with Juliette style balcony, fitted shutters, extensive views towards the sea, Foredown Tower and The South Downs.

OPEN PLAN LIVING SPACE 24'6 x 9'4 (7.47m x 2.84m)

KITCHEN AREA
Extensive range of eye level and base units comprising of cupboards and drawers, recessed under cupboard lighting, work surfaces and return, stainless steel one and a half bowl sink and drainer unit with mixer tap, built in 'Zanussi' electric hob with glass splashback, extractor hood over, 'Zanussi' electric fan assisted oven under, integrated slim line dishwasher, integrated washing/dryer and integrated fridge freezer, luxury vinyl flooring, hard wired smoke detector, extractor fan.

LOUNGE AREA
Westerly aspect, ceiling light point, hardwired smoke detector, extractor venting, wall mounted digital control panel for heating and hot water, cupboard housing 'Vaillant' gas combination boiler for heating and hot water, double opening casement doors with fitted shutters providing access to

BALCONY 9'5 x 3'6 (2.87m x 1.07m)
Westerly aspect offering views to the sea, Foredown Tower and The South Downs, rail surround and decking.

OUTSIDE

COMMUNAL GARDENS

COMMUNAL BIKE STORE
Secure key fob entry, additional external bike shelter. Gas Meter.

COMMUNAL BIN STORE
Secure key fob entry.

PARKING SPACE
Allocated parking space-letter 'O'.

OUTGOINGS
Council Tax: Band B.
Leasehold: 246 years remaining.
Annual Service Charge: £130.39 per month.
Ground Rent: £200 per annum.
